Anheuser-Busch’s MCC OKC Lid Plant: 38 years of lid production and innovation

For more than 38 years, Anheuser-Busch’s Metal Container Corporation Oklahoma City Lid Plant (MCC OKC) has produced aluminum lids for the beverage industry with a simple dream: "World Class Performance." Located in the heart of Oklahoma City, the plant typically produces more than 40 million lids a day, or 13 billion annually.

The Chamber visits Atlanta for its annual InterCity Visit

Each year, the Greater Oklahoma City Chamber organizes the InterCity Visit benchmarking trip to assess the city's progress compared to competing markets. This trip offers business and community leaders the chance to explore the assets and opportunities of other regions.

Oklahoma launches inaugural Aerospace Week, April 1-7

The Oklahoma City Innovation District, in collaboration with The Oklahoma Department of Aerospace and Aeronautics, is launching the state's first annual Aerospace Week. It will take place April 1-7 and will have events for all ages.
